Carrier Acquires Distributor

Posted by Dan Doran in HVAC MA

Carrier announced that it completed the acquisition of E.B. Ward & Company, a well established distributor of Carrier HVAC products.  E.B. Ward had revenues of approximately $150 million.

ARS Acquires 24/7 Service Corp

Posted by Dan Doran in HVAC MA

American Residential Service, LLC, a nationwide HVAC services company, recently acquired 24/7 Service Corp. 24/7 is a Las Vegas based HVAC , plumbing and sheet metal company that serviced the Las Vegas and Phoenix markets.

ARS now has a solid service footprint throughout the southwest U.S.
